Makukula Set To Miss Euro 2008

Portuguese daily Record understands Benfica striker Ariza Makukula will not feature in Luiz Felipe Scolari's call-up list for Euro 2008...

The Portuguese footballer scored in his debut for the national squad in October, against Kazakhstan, in what seemed to be an auspicious start to his international career.

He would make three further appearances for Portugal, against Armenia, Finland and Italy, and it looked as if the 27-year-old had guaranteed a place in Scolari's plans for Euro 2008.

However, the Congolese-born striker has found first-team chances at Benfica very much limited since he moved to Lisbon in January. This is something he has expressed disappointment in, despite claiming that there have not been any conflicts between himself and interim boss Fernando Chalana.

And Scolari, who often uses just one striker in his formation, will reportedly call up Nuno Gomes, Hugo Almeida and Hélder Postiga for the tournament in Austria and Switzerland.
